Eligibility Criteria for the Child Care and Development Fund Pre-Application

Eligibility to apply for Indiana child care services is determined by several criteria. Primarily, applicants must be Indiana residents and meet specific income limits, which vary according to household size. This ensures that assistance is directed toward families in genuine need of support.
Furthermore, certain special circumstances, such as parental employment status or child care needs due to medical conditions, can influence eligibility. It is crucial for applicants to evaluate their situation against these criteria to ascertain their qualifications for the child care assistance pre-application.

Required Documents and Supporting Materials for the Pre-Application

Before submitting the child care assistance form, applicants need to gather essential documentation. Required materials typically include:
  • Pay stubs from recent employment.
  • Tax returns for the previous year.
  • Proof of child care costs.
  • Identification documents for all household members.

Eligibility for the Child Care and Development Fund Pre-Application generally includes Indiana residents who require financial assistance for child care. Income limits may apply, so it is essential to check specific criteria related to household income and size.
Applicants must submit supporting documents such as pay stubs and proof of household income. Including accurate and complete documentation helps to process your application quickly.
The Child Care and Development Fund Pre-Application must be renewed every 90 days. Be sure to complete the renewal promptly to avoid interruptions in your child care assistance.
You must submit the completed form directly to the Children’s Bureau, Inc. in Muncie, IN. Ensure to follow the submission guidelines provided within the application to avoid issues.
Common mistakes include missing signatures, providing incomplete information, and omitting necessary documentation. Carefully review your application to ensure all sections are complete before submission.
No fees are typically charged for submitting the Child Care and Development Fund Pre-Application. However, be aware of any potential costs related to obtaining required documentation, such as pay stubs.
The processing time for the Child Care and Development Fund Pre-Application can vary. Generally, it may take several weeks. It's advisable to submit your application well in advance of needing child care assistance.
